The Village Federation are seeking to appoint a new Head of School for Brassington Primary School, a small village school with 55 pupils. 

This role is a rare opportunity for an aspiring leader or for a teacher who wants to remain in the classroom whilst also having leadership responsibilities through managing the day-to-day running of the school. 

The Village Federation has a unique set-up whereby the Head of School role is similar to the traditional small-school teaching head model, but where the Executive Headteacher maintains responsibility for governance, administration, budgeting and many other aspects of running the school. This means that the Head of School can focus on teaching, learning and all the things that are directly to do with the children, including working with parents and carers as the face of the school. 

 The successful candidate will have a maximum of 4 days teaching commitment within the school, with a day of release time for management and PPA. They will be part of a wider senior-leadership team with three other Heads of School, a Federation SENCO, Business Manager and the Executive Headteacher. The starting point on the salary range is negotiable for candidates who may already have leadership experience or an existing salary within the range.
